The journey from Patori to Samastipur spans approximately 45 kilometers through the heart of North Bihar. You can choose between local passenger trains or state-run buses for this short transit. The route passes through rural landscapes and small agricultural hubs. Trains are generally more reliable during the monsoon season when road conditions fluctuate. Expect a travel time of roughly 90 minutes regardless of the mode chosen.

Total Distance: 45 km by road, 40 km air distance.
Fastest Way
Train travel is the fastest, taking about 75 minutes under normal conditions.
Cheapest Way
Local passenger train, costing approximately 50 INR, is the most economical option.

Duration 1 hour 15 mins 1 hour 45 mins
Avg Price 50-100 INR 80-120 INR
Operator Indian Railways Bihar State Road Transport Corporation
Route Patori Station to Samastipur Junction via Mohiuddinnagar. Via SH 50 and SH 88.
Tip Check the NTES app for real-time train status as local trains often face minor delays. Buses are available from the main Patori market area throughout the day.

People Also Ask
  • Is there a direct train from Patori to Samastipur?
    Yes, several local passenger trains run daily between Patori and Samastipur Junction.
  • How long does it take by bus?
    The bus journey typically takes between 1.5 to 2 hours depending on traffic conditions.
  • Are there taxis available?
    Private taxis can be hired from Patori market, but they are significantly more expensive than buses.
  • What is the best time to start?
    Starting early in the morning is recommended to avoid midday heat and traffic.
  • Is the road condition good?
    The state highways are generally motorable, though some patches may have potholes during the rainy season.
